Flight Simulator "Ipilot" Appears In Dubai

Dubai offers everyone to become a pilot of the Boeing 737-800 passenger airliner.

The first Ipilot flight simulator in the emirate will open for residents and tourists on November 20 at The Dubai Mall, next to the Sega Republic entertainment center. By operating the simulator, you can take off and land at one of 24 thousand airports around the world. Each flight is accompanied by a professional instructor, while everything that happens in the cockpit is as close to reality as possible.

"Dubai is a great place where flights on our simulator will be available to everyone, regardless of status. Our good location in one of the largest shopping malls in the world, The Dubai Mall will add adrenaline to the daily shopping trip for all guests," said Wolfram Schleter , CEO of iPilot.

All flights are divided into four categories - from amateur ones lasting 15 minutes to professional ones, which last an entire hour.
